Subject: [3/6] dma: tegra: fix incorrect case of DMA
Date: Wed, 31 Oct 2018 16:03:06 +0000 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20181031160309.20408-4-ben.dooks@codethink.co.uk> (raw)
The use of Dma is annoying, since it is an acronym so should be all
upper case. Fix this throughout the driver.
